State of Tennessee Bledsoe County July Sessions 1819-

We the undersigned Justices of the peace for Bledsoe County having been acquain =ted with James Rodgers Esquire attorney at Law for a number of years past, and be lieving him well qualified to Discharge the du =ties devolving on a Solicitor Genl do there fore recommend Mr Rodgers to the notice of your Excellency for that appointment to fill the vacancy occasioned by the resignation of Thos J. Campbell Esq solicitor Genl Resigned

very respectfully your Excellencies most Obt humble serts

Saml Smith Jas Hoge Jesse Walker Jas Skillern George Vaughan William Nail Alexander [Laurels?]

His Excellency Joseph McMinn Esq
